Data Preparation and Selection

A. Identifying and collecting relevant data

  1. Types of data: When creating interactive dashboards, it is essential to work with different types of data, including numerical, categorical, and time-series data. Each type of data requires specific visualization techniques tailored to its characteristics.
  2. Data sources: Data can be sourced from various platforms such as databases, spreadsheets, and APIs. Ensuring data quality and integrity is crucial for the accuracy of the visualizations.

B. Cleaning and transforming data

  1. Handling missing values: Dealing with missing data points is essential to prevent inaccuracies in the dashboard visualizations. Imputation techniques or data exclusion strategies can be employed to address missing values.
  2. Data normalization and aggregation: Standardizing data to a common scale and aggregating data points for better insights are critical steps in preparing data for visualization.

C. Defining data visualizations

  1. Choosing appropriate chart types: Selecting the right chart types, such as bar charts, line charts, and pie charts, based on the data and the insights you aim to communicate is fundamental for effective dashboard design.
  2. Selecting parameters: Customizing chart parameters like axes, legends, and colors enhances the clarity and interpretability of visualizations.

Dashboard Design

A. User interface design principles

  1. Layout and navigation: Designing a user-friendly layout and intuitive navigation flow ensures a seamless user experience while interacting with the dashboard.
  2. Color schemes and typography: Utilizing appropriate color schemes and typography enhances visual appeal and readability of the dashboard content.

B. Dashboard components

  1. Widgets: Incorporating various widgets such as charts, gauges, and tables allows for diverse data representation and comparison.
  2. Filters and controls: Including interactive filters and controls empowers users to customize their data views and focus on specific information.
  3. Annotations and tooltips: Adding annotations and tooltips provides contextual information and clarifies data points for improved understanding.

C. Best practices for dashboard design

  1. Simplicity and clarity: Keeping design elements simple and clear avoids clutter and ensures easy interpretation of the data.
  2. Consistency and alignment: Maintaining consistency in design elements and proper alignment of components enhances the professional look and usability of the dashboard.
  3. Interactivity and engagement: Incorporating interactive features boosts user engagement and facilitates data exploration for meaningful insights.

Tool Selection

A. Types of dashboarding tools

  1. Cloud-based platforms: Tools like Tableau, Power BI, and Google Data Studio offer robust features for creating interactive dashboards in a cloud environment.
  2. Open-source tools: Platforms like Plotly, Dash, and Grafana provide flexibility and customization options for dashboard development.

B. Features to consider

  1. Data connectivity and integration: The ability to connect to various data sources and integrate seamlessly with different databases is essential for a comprehensive dashboarding tool.
  2. Chart customization capabilities: Tools with extensive chart customization options enable users to tailor visualizations to specific requirements effectively.
  3. Interactivity options: Evaluating the interactivity features of dashboarding tools helps in choosing platforms that support dynamic data exploration.

Frequently Asked Questions

What is an interactive dashboard?

An interactive dashboard is a data visualization tool that allows users to explore and analyze data by interacting with various elements, such as charts, graphs, and filters.

What are the benefits of creating interactive dashboards?

Interactive dashboards help users to gain insights quickly, make data-driven decisions, and present complex information in a simple and engaging manner. They also facilitate real-time data analysis and collaboration among team members.

What tools can be used to create interactive dashboards?

Popular tools for creating interactive dashboards include Tableau, Power BI, QlikView, Google Data Studio, and D3.js. These tools offer a range of features and customization options to build visually appealing and interactive dashboards.

How can I make my interactive dashboard impactful for data presentation?

To make your interactive dashboard impactful, focus on visual design, usability, and storytelling. Use clear and concise visuals, interactive elements, and intuitive navigation to guide users through the data. Additionally, consider the audience’s needs and objectives to tailor the dashboard for maximum impact.

What are some best practices for designing interactive dashboards?

Some best practices for designing interactive dashboards include defining clear goals and key metrics, organizing data logically, using consistent color schemes and fonts, providing user-friendly navigation, and testing the dashboard with real users for feedback and improvements.
